Course Content

• Health Emergency Risk Assessment and Management
• Disaster Epidemiology and Surveillance
• Public Health Emergency Response Operations
• Health Emergency Communication and Community Engagement
• Logistics and Resource Management in Health Emergencies
• Health Sector Collaboration and Coordination in Emergencies
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Health Emergency Response
• Post-Incident Evaluation and Learning in Health Emergency Response Planning and Implementation

Career path

Career Role (Health Emergency Response Planning & Implementation) Description
Emergency Planning Officer Develops and implements emergency plans for healthcare settings, ensuring business continuity and preparedness for major incidents. High demand for expertise in risk assessment and mitigation.
Disaster Response Coordinator Leads and coordinates the response to major health emergencies, managing resources and personnel effectively. Critical role requiring strong leadership and communication skills in crisis management.
Public Health Emergency Planning Specialist Focuses on the public health aspects of emergency response, including disease outbreaks and mass casualty events. Requires advanced understanding of epidemiology and public health policy.
Healthcare Resilience Manager Develops and implements strategies to enhance the resilience of healthcare systems, preparing them for future challenges. A key role in future-proofing healthcare provision.
Pandemic Preparedness Officer Specializes in planning and mitigation strategies for pandemics and other widespread infectious disease outbreaks. Expertise in infectious disease control and prevention is vital.
